Main conclusions – National Authorities
In favour of:
»
Harmonisation (52%) of e-booking / check-in
practices through EU law (75%)
»
Provision of minimum time for detecting an error in
reservation & avoiding unreasonable fees for checkin (40% strongly agree, 24% somewhat agree)
»
Minimum rules in case of rescheduling (76%) &
choice of not flying or reimbursement when more
than 5 hrs delay (56% strongly agree)
»
Obliging air carriers to inform passengers of changes
(68%)
»
Rules to clarify the no-show policy (60%)

Main conclusions – Industry Group
.
Oppose
» Harmonisation of e-booking / check in practices (72%).
» Introduction of minimum rules in case of rescheduling (56%)
and choice of not flying or reimbursement when more than
5 hrs delay (51% strongly disagree)
» Rules to clarify the no-show policy (59%)
Divided on
» Minimum time for detecting an error in reservation (48%
strongly disagree) and avoiding unreasonable fees for
check-in (40% strongly disagree).
» Obligation of air carriers to inform passengers of changes
(26% strongly agree, 37% strongly disagree)

Main conclusions – Consumer Group
In favour of:
» Harmonisation of e-booking / check-in practices (75%)
through EU law (77%)
» Introducing a minimum time for detecting errors in
reservation (70% strongly agree) and avoiding
unreasonable fees for check-in (81% strongly agree)
» Minimum rules in case of rescheduling (94%) and
choice of not flying or reimbursement when more
than 5 hrs delay (81% strongly agree).
» Obligation to air carriers to inform passengers of
changes (85% strongly agree)
» Rules to clarify the no-show policy (84%)

Main conclusions - Airports
In favour of:
»
Harmonisation of e-booking / check in practices (71%)
through voluntary agreements (45%)
»
Minimum time for detecting errors in reservation (36%
strongly agree, 29% somewhat agree) and avoiding
unreasonable fees for check-in (57.1% strongly agree)
»
Minimum rules in case of rescheduling of flights (71%)
and choice of not flying or reimbursement when more
than 5 hrs delay (43% strongly agree, 36% somewhat
agree)
»
Requiring air carriers to inform passengers of changes
(64% strongly agree)
»
Rules to clarify the no-show policy (57%)
